Key Features Quick Reference

X-Paxos HA

Multi-replica high availability based on X-Paxos consensus protocol. At most one Leader handles all writes; Followers participate in majority voting. Automatic failover with RPO=0 (zero data loss). Performance comparable to MySQL semi-synchronous replication.

Three essential monitoring views (always mention all three by name when discussing cluster health):

  1. INFORMATION_SCHEMA.ALISQL_CLUSTER_GLOBAL — Cluster topology (all nodes' roles, sync progress). IMPORTANT: Only returns data on the Leader node; returns empty result set on Follower/Logger nodes. If you get empty results, you are likely connected to a Follower — reconnect to the Leader.
  2. INFORMATION_SCHEMA.ALISQL_CLUSTER_LOCAL — Current node's local status. Key fields: CURRENT_LEADER (shows which node is Leader), INSTANCE_TYPE (Normal or Log). Use this to identify the current Leader address before querying ALISQL_CLUSTER_GLOBAL.
  3. INFORMATION_SCHEMA.ALISQL_CLUSTER_HEALTH — Replication health metrics. Key fields: LOG_DELAY_NUM (log shipping lag), APPLY_DELAY_NUM (log apply lag), APPLY_DELAY_SECONDS.
-- Step 1: Check local status and find the Leader address
SELECT * FROM INFORMATION_SCHEMA.ALISQL_CLUSTER_LOCAL;
-- Step 2: Cluster topology (must run on Leader node, returns empty on Followers)
SELECT * FROM INFORMATION_SCHEMA.ALISQL_CLUSTER_GLOBAL;
-- Step 3: Replication health
SELECT * FROM INFORMATION_SCHEMA.ALISQL_CLUSTER_HEALTH;

Lizard Transaction System

SCN (System Commit Number) based MVCC replacing InnoDB's native transaction visibility. Write transactions commit by writing SCN to a Transaction Slot; read transactions compare record SCN against a single-number Vision (no active transaction ID array). Supports FlashBack Query via SCN.

Performance vs MySQL 8.0.32 (Sysbench RW, 512 concurrency): 30% higher throughput, 53% lower latency.

Panda Index

Deadlock-free unique key index. Eliminates Gap locks under RC isolation by optimizing constraint checks to row-level lock granularity. No performance overhead; 28 extra bytes per unique index record.

-- Enable (session or global, no restart needed)
SET opt_index_format_panda_enabled = ON;
  • Default ON for instances created after 2025-06-04.
  • Requires storage node version >= xcluster8.4.20-20250527.
  • Only optimizes RC isolation; RR still uses Next-Key locks.
  • Existing indexes need manual rebuild (see panda-index.md).
